やったこと 行番号の表示 Meadow起動時のスプラッシュを非表示 ESS用のM-x alignの設定 .cpp用のflymakeの設定 必要だったもの linum.el gcc(Cygwinから導入済み) .emacs ;; linum.el(行番号の表示) (require 'linum) (global-linum-mode t) (setq linum-format "%5d") ;; 起動時の画面を表示させない (setq inhibit-startup-message t) ;; M-x alignの設定 for ESS (require 'align) (add-to-list 'align-rules-list '(ess-assignment-operator (regexp . "\\(\\s-*\\)<-[^#\t\n]") (repeat . nil) (modes
英単語などのスペルチェック.flyspell-modeを使えばMS Wordなんかであるようなリアルタイムでのチェック(波線が付くやつ)もできる.大変便利なので導入してない人は至急導入するように. 要るもの Meadow(3.0使った) Cygwin やること Cygwinのsetup.exeから以下のものをインストール. aspell aspell-doc aspell-en libaspell15 .emacsに以下の記述を追加. (setq ispell-program-name "aspell") (setq ispell-grep-command "grep") (eval-after-load "ispell" '(add-to-list 'ispell-skip-region-alist '("[^\000-\377]"))) これだけ.カンタン!(参考: Spell che
GulfweedさんのTopCoderのエントリに従ってプラグインを入れると自分の好きなエディタでTopCoderに参加することができます。それに加えて,Emacsでflymakeを使えばエラーに気付きやすくなります。(結局何を.emacsに書けばいいのかは追記を見てください) 上のスクリーンショットではint型とunsignedなものを比較してるのでwarningがでてますね. flymakeはカレントディレクトリの中にあるMakefileを実行してエラーを教えてくれます。最初のほうでMakefileを使う方法を紹介し、その下の追記でMakefileを使わない方法を紹介しまてます。 .emacs.el ;; Flymake (require 'flymake) ;; ;; C++ ;; ;; http://d.hatena.ne.jp/pyopyopyo/20070715/ (add-h
;;; linum.el --- Display line numbers to the left of buffers ;; Copyright (C) 2007, 2008 Markus Triska ;; Author: Markus Triska ;; Keywords: convenience ;; This file is free software; you can redistribute it and/or modify ;; it under the terms of the GNU General Public License as published by ;; the Free Software Foundation; either version 3, or (at your option) ;; any later version. ;; This file
Amazonさんのダンボール箱でつくる、A4書類がピッタリ入るファイルケース。 型紙はフリーダウンロードできますよ。 たくさんつくって重ねると、多段式ファイル引き出しになります。 もうどの家にもひとつやふたつはきっとあるAmazonさんのダンボール箱。 「材料ってどこで手に入るんですか?」 っていう質問がいちばん多いマゴクラとしては、これを使わない手はありません。 Amazonのダンボール箱も種類が豊富にあるようですが、 おそらく最も流通量が多いと思われる(マゴクラ調べ)、ウラ面に『BX0110』と書かれたダンボール箱を使います。 この『BX0110』、ジッパー形式で開くようになっていて、中身は台紙にビニールで固定されているタイプなのです。 言い忘れましたがこのファイルケース、ひとつ作るのにダンボール箱は2個必要ですよ。比較的入手しやすいダンボール箱だとは思いますけれども。 では材料の準備
ようやくEmacs&ESSにも慣れて、少しはRの生産性も上がってきたかな、という今日この頃。といっても、まだ思うように使いこなせなくてじれったい日々が続いております。最近では.emacsの改造に目覚めしまい、ネットで良さそうな拡張を見つけるたびに写経しては試しを繰り返して無駄な時間を過ごしています。 そんな中、ソースコードの整形のような記事を見つけたので、これをRのソースコードにも活かせないかなと思って少し調べてみました。単純にはリージョンを選択して"M-x align-regexp"で"<-"と指定するとできますが、いささか面倒なのでもう少し簡単な方法で。写経してちょっと変えただけなので実際何をしているのか全く分からないのですが... これを.emacsに突っ込むと"M-x align"で整列ができます。 ;;M-x alignの設定 for ESS (require 'align) (
! 最新版 Visual C++ 2010 Express のプログラミング入門はこちらをご覧ください。 ! このページは旧バージョンについての情報になります。 はじめに ここでは「Microsoft Visual C++ 2008 Express Edition」を使ったC言語プログラミングの学習方法について説明します。 「Microsoft Visual C++ 2008 Express Edition」のインストール方法については、 こちらをご覧ください。 すぐに始めたい人のためのムービー プロジェクトの作り方(2.4MB)/ソースファイルの作り方(3.7MB) new! もくじ Windows アプリケーションとコンソールアプリケーション プロジェクトの管理 プロジェクトとソースファイルの作成 プログラムの作成と実行 保存したプロジェクトを開く プログラムのデバッグ実行 Wind
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く